Stopped in to check this place out after working in the KC area. Of the establishments in the area of McCoy’s, this is probably the most welcome stop for the average craft beer enthusiast. Most of the other bars seem to stick to macros or Boulevard on tap. The feel was typical brewpub and the service was OK. The selection varied, but they skewed to the lighter side, with a light lager, red, ipa, dry stout, raspberry, and brown ale being the primary choices. No heavy hitters were in the lineup. Didn’t order food, as it was more important to hit up some authentic KC bar-b-que at Arthur Bryants. Overall, the place seemed too interested in catering to the college snob crowd, and by serving coors, bud, and michelob on the side, showed they are more interested in turning a buck than actually showing their love of beer.

Beautiful brewpub centrally located in the Westport district of Kansas City. The only pub I know of that has a ’cigar lounge’. Keith, the brewer, does an excellent job of maintaining a variety of beers on tap (6 or 7). His GABF award winning ’Ginger Shandy’ is to die for.

They have added more taps recently, and now feature a brown, an IPA, a stout, a light, a rasberry light, a wheat (varies with season) and a shandy. At all times they have at least two seasonals on tap as well. Great place to meet and talk with friends or simply people watch. Brown is superb, as are the seasonal porter, scottish ale and Mai Bock.
